Lady GaGa 'makes £100 from Spotify'
Published Monday, Nov 23 2009, 19:49 GMT | By Oli Simpson

Swedish newspaper Expressen published a report which says that the singer - real name Stefani Germanotta - has only earned that amount despite her huge popularity on the music streaming service.
The figure quoted by the publication represents the amount of listens GaGa's hit 'Poker Face' has amassed over a five-month period in Spotify's native Sweden.
Swedish rapper Dogge Doggelito said: "It is totally sick. We musicians have no rights, you may not charge [for music] anymore."
However, another of the country's artists, music producer Alexander Bard, stated that this payment is still better than what GaGa would have received from illegal downloading, noting it to be "more than zero".
